Pesticide Residue Detector (Suitcase model)

INOPRP is designed in accordance with the pesticide residue testing standards of the World Health Organization (WHO) and the Food and Agriculture Organization (FAO), as well as the reference intake levels of the Environmental Protection Agency (EPA). It employs an enzyme inhibition rate colorimetric method to rapidly and accurately detect the content of organophosphorus and carbamate pesticides in agricultural and forestry products such as fruits and vegetables.

FEATURES

1. The chassis is made of industrial-grade ABS engineering plastic, making it easy to carry, sturdy, and durable, ideal for mobile testing.  

2. Runs on the Android operating system with a more user-friendly interface. The main controller uses a multi-core processor with a clock speed of 1.88 GHz, ensuring faster operation and greater stability.

3. Automatically determines whether samples meet standards, with results displayed in an intuitive manner.  

4. The instrument includes a database of over 100 vegetable names, organized by category, with the ability to add or remove vegetable names as needed, edit vegetable names, and directly print vegetable names.  

5. Testing channels: 6 testing channels allow simultaneous testing of multiple samples, with continuous testing capability. Samples can be tested immediately upon placement, with each sample operated independently by the program to prevent interference.  

6. The instrument has Wi-Fi networking functionality, enabling rapid data upload to a computer for data management and statistics. It also features 4G signal GPRS remote transmission functionality, allowing a SIM card to be inserted to achieve data transmission to a remote platform. 

7. Display method: 7-inch high-sensitivity true-color touchscreen display with a user-friendly Chinese interface, providing intuitive and simple readings.  

8. The printer uses a 5V serial port for printing, with options for manual or automatic printing. Results are printed within three minutes, with the format including the tester's name, absorbance difference, testing time, testing institution, sample name, and result determination. 

9. The light source uses imported ultra-high-brightness LEDs, featuring low power consumption, high precision, strong stability, controllable light sources (unused light sources can be turned off), and fast response speed.  

10. Intelligent constant current voltage regulation, automatic light intensity calibration, and no temperature drift of the light source during prolonged continuous operation.

11. The instrument is designed with a USB 2.0 interface for convenient data storage and transfer, and can be directly connected to a computer at any time. It can also be controlled by a computer to perform data querying, browsing, analysis, statistics, and printing.

12. The instrument has a high degree of intelligence and features self-testing functions: it includes power-on self-testing and zeroing functions, as well as automatic detection of repeatability. 

13. The instrument has self-protection functionality, allowing users to set usernames and passwords to prevent unauthorized operation.  

14. Uses DC 12V power supply for enhanced safety, and can be equipped with a 6A lithium-ion battery charger.  

15. The instrument has functions for re-calibration, locking, and restoring factory settings.
